Mounting bolts from frame to Rv front sidewall are in 3/8” lag bolt mounted in pine wood (all are striped, won’t tighten). This allows the complete front Rv wall to move allowing further frame issues. Holes in frame rail are 1/2” , grand design installed smaller lag bolts 3/8” this has caused the bolts to eventually fail. This is happening on approximately 30% or more of Grand Design RVs. The factory needs to provide a recall on this problem.

Grand Design RV, LLC (Grand Design) is recalling certain 2013-2021 Momentum, Solitude, and Reflection recreational vehicles. A 110-volt wire in the refrigerator cabinet may be improperly secured, which could result in the wire contacting the refrigerator cooling unit, causing an electrical arc.
Consequence & remedy
Consequence: An electrical arc increases the risk of a fire.
Remedy: Dealers will inspect and replace any damaged wiring, and properly secure the wires,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ed on February 21, 2022. Owners may contact Grand Design customer service at 1-574-825-9679. Grand Design's number for this recall is 910026.
Grand Design RV (Grand Design) is recalling certain model year 2015-2016 Momentum toy haulers and Solitude recreational trailers manufactured July 8, 2014, to August 31, 2015, equipped with certain aluminum black ladders manufactured by Christianson Industries. These ladders have retractable hinges, each with a welded 'top hat' that can separate from the hinge.
Consequence & remedy
Consequence: If the hinges separate from the ladder while in use, the ladder may fall from the vehicle, increasing the risk of injury.
Remedy: Grand Design will notify owners, and dealers will install a bracket over the back of existing hinges, free of charge. The recall began on December 16, 2016. Owners may contact Grand Design customer service at 1-574-825-9679. Grand Design's number for this recall is 910008.
